ACTIVE TEST
Operation procedure
CAUTION:
lDo not perform active test wheel running.
lBe sure completely bleed air from brake system.
lActive test cannot be performed with ABS warning lamp on.
1. Connect CONSULT-II to data link connector and start engine.
2. Touch “START” on the display.
3. Touch “ABS”.
4. Touch “ACTIVE TEST”.
5. Test item selection screen is displayed.
6. Touch test item.
7. Touch “START” with “MAIN SIGNALS” line inverted.
8. Active test screen is displayed.

BASIC INSPECTION 1 BRAKE FLUID LEVEL AND LEAKAGE INSPECTION
1. Check fluid level in brake reservoir tank. If fluid level is low, refill brake fluid.
2. Check area around brake piping and ABS actuator for leaks. If a leak or oozing is detected, check as fol-
lows:
lIf connections at ABS actuator are loose, tighten piping to the specified torque. Then check again for
leaks, and be sure there is no fluid leak.
lIf the flare nuts at the connections and the threads of the ABS actuator are damaged, replace the dam-
aged parts. Then check again for leaks, and make sure that there is no fluid leak.
lIf leak or oozing is detected except for ABS actuator connections, wipe it with clean cloth. Then check
again for leaks. If there is still leak or oozing, replace damaged part.
lIf leak or oozing is detected on ABS actuator, wipe with a clean cloth. Check again for leaks, and if
there is still leak or oozing, replace ABS actuator.
CAUTION:
ABS actuator body cannot be disassembled.
BASIC INSPECTION 2 INSPECTION FOR LOOSE POWER SUPPLY TERMINAL
Check battery for looseness on battery positive/negative terminals and ground connection.
BASIC INSPECTION 3 ABS/4WD WARNING LAMP INSPECTION
1. Be sure ABS warning lamp turns on when ignition switch is turned ON. If it does not turn on, check ABS
warning lamp harness.
2. Check 4WD warning lamp illuminates with ignition switch ON. If not so, check 4WD warning lamp path.
3. Be sure ABS warning lamp turns off after approximately 1 second when ignition switch is turned ON. If it
does not turn off, perform self-diagnosis.
4. Be sure 4WD warning lamp turns off after several seconds when engine is started. If it does not turn off,
perform self-diagnosis.
5. After driving the vehicle at Approx. 30km/h for a few seconds, check 4WD warning lamp and ABS warning
lamp do not illuminate.
6. After completing the self-diagnosis, always erase the diagnosis memory.

2.CONNECTOR INSPECTION
1. Disconnect the 4WD/ABS control unit connector E122 and the 4WD solenoid connector B152. Check that
terminals are not deformed. Check that the connectors were connected properly. Reconnect connectors.
2. Perform self-diagnosis again.
OK or NG
OK >> Diagnosis completed.
NG >> GO TO 3.
3.INSPECTION OF 4WD SOLENOID UNIT
1. Disconnect connector B152 and check resistance between terminals No.1 (L/W) and 2 (LG).
OK or NG
OK >> GO TO 4.
NG >> Replace 4WD solenoid.
4.INSPECTION OF 4WD SOLENOID CIRCUIT HARNESS
1. Disconnect the 4WD solenoid connector.
2. Disconnect the 4WD/ABS control unit.
3. Check the circuit continuity between control unit harness connector E122 terminal No.102 (LG) and 4WD
solenoid harness connector B152 terminal No.2 (LG).
4. Disconnect the 4WD actuator relay connector.
5. Check circuit continuity between 4WD solenoid harness connector B152 terminal No.1 (L/W) and 4WD
actuator relay connector E10 terminal No.5 (L/W)
OK or NG
OK >> GO TO 5.
NG >> Repair or replace the harness.
5.CHECK 4WD ACTUATOR RELAY AND CONNECTOR
1. Check the 4WD actuator relay and control unit harness connector.
2. Check the 4WD actuator relay unit.
OK or NG
OK >> GO TO 6.
NG >> Repair or replace 4WD actuator relay and connector.
